Output 34d204878dfb1978d32bc58ee76c7ab9a606e7f19912f0b5871b8401885de34f:1

value
43339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13c3e2b2d139e322f1fc8d3a0d9694e56cb6e13c OP_EQUALVERIFY OP_CHECKSIG
address
12oWW1dFJYcjMxkGk39X6HSCqsh5qjAPkM
transaction
34d204878dfb1978d32bc58ee76c7ab9a606e7f19912f0b5871b8401885de34f
confirmations
388853
spent
true